REST Resource: spaces

المرجع: المساحة

مكان افتراضي يتم فيه عقد المؤتمرات يمكن عقد اجتماع فيديو نشط واحد فقط في مساحة واحدة في أي وقت.

تمثيل JSON
{
  "name": string,
  "meetingUri": string,
  "meetingCode": string,
  "config": {
    object (SpaceConfig)
  },
  "activeConference": {
    object (ActiveConference)
  }
}
الحقول
name

string

غير قابل للتغيير اسم المورد للمساحة

التنسيق: spaces/{space}

{space} هو معرّف المورد للمساحة. وهو معرّف فريد ينشئه الخادم وهو حسّاس لحالة الأحرف. مثلاً: jQCFfuBOdN5z

لمزيد من المعلومات، يُرجى الاطّلاع على كيفية تحديد Meet لمساحة اجتماع.

meetingUri

string

النتائج فقط. عنوان URL المستخدَم للانضمام إلى الاجتماعات ويتألف من https://meet.google.com/ متبوعًا بـ meetingCode. على سبيل المثال، https://meet.google.com/abc-mnop-xyz.

meetingCode

string

النتائج فقط. اكتب سلسلة فريدة وسهلة الاستخدام تُستخدَم للانضمام إلى الاجتماع.

التنسيق: [a-z]+-[a-z]+-[a-z]+ مثلاً: abc-mnop-xyz

الحد الأقصى لعدد الأحرف المسموح به هو 128 حرفًا.

لا يمكن استخدامه إلا كعنوان بديل لاسم المساحة للحصول على المساحة.

config

object (SpaceConfig)

الإعدادات المتعلّقة بمساحة الاجتماع

activeConference

object (ActiveConference)

المؤتمر النشط، إن توفّر

SpaceConfig

الإعدادات المتعلّقة بمساحة اجتماع

تمثيل JSON
{
  "accessType": enum (AccessType),
  "entryPointAccess": enum (EntryPointAccess),
  "moderation": enum (Moderation),
  "moderationRestrictions": {
    object (ModerationRestrictions)
  },
  "attendanceReportGenerationType": enum (AttendanceReportGenerationType),
  "artifactConfig": {
    object (ArtifactConfig)
  }
}
الحقول
accessType

enum (AccessType)

نوع الوصول إلى مساحة الاجتماع الذي يحدِّد المستخدمين الذين يمكنهم الانضمام بدون طلب الانضمام الإعداد التلقائي: إعدادات الوصول التلقائية للمستخدم. يتحكم فيه مشرف المستخدم لمستخدمي المؤسسات أو RESTRICTED.

entryPointAccess

enum (EntryPointAccess)

تُحدِّد نقاط الدخول التي يمكن استخدامها للانضمام إلى الاجتماعات المستضافة في مساحة الاجتماعات هذه. الإعداد التلقائي: EntryPointAccess.ALL

moderation

enum (Moderation)

وضع الإشراف الذي تم ضبطه مسبقًا للاجتماع. الإعداد التلقائي: يتم التحكّم فيه من خلال سياسات المستخدم.

moderationRestrictions

object (ModerationRestrictions)

عندما يكون وضع الإشراف مفعّلاً، يتم تطبيق هذه القيود على الاجتماع. عندما يكون وضع الإشراف "غير مفعّل"، ستتم إعادة ضبطه على الإعدادات التلقائية "قيود الإشراف".

attendanceReportGenerationType

enum (AttendanceReportGenerationType)

ما إذا كان تقرير الحضور مفعّلاً لمساحة الاجتماع

artifactConfig

object (ArtifactConfig)

الإعدادات المتعلقة بالعناصر المنشأة تلقائيًا التي يتيح الاجتماع استخدامها

AccessType

أنواع الوصول المحتملة لمساحة اجتماع

عمليات التعداد
ACCESS_TYPE_UNSPECIFIED القيمة التلقائية التي حدّدتها مؤسسة المستخدم. ملاحظة: لا يتم عرض هذا العنصر مطلقًا، لأنّه يتم عرض نوع الوصول الذي تم ضبطه بدلاً منه.
OPEN يمكن لأي شخص لديه معلومات الانضمام (مثل عنوان URL أو معلومات الوصول إلى الهاتف) الانضمام بدون طلب الانضمام.
TRUSTED يمكن لأعضاء مؤسسة المضيف والمستخدمين الخارجيين المدعوين ومستخدمي الاتصال الهاتفي الانضمام بدون طلب الإذن. وعلى أي شخص آخر طلب الانضمام.
RESTRICTED يمكن فقط للمدعوين الانضمام بدون الحاجة إلى طلب الإذن. وعلى أي شخص آخر طلب الانضمام.

EntryPointAccess

نقاط الدخول التي يمكن استخدامها للانضمام إلى اجتماع مثال: meet.google.com أو حزمة تطوير البرامج (SDK) لميزة "دمج Meet" على الويب أو تطبيق جوّال.

عمليات التعداد
ENTRY_POINT_ACCESS_UNSPECIFIED غير مستخدَمة
ALL جميع نقاط الدخول مسموح بها.
CREATOR_APP_ONLY لا يمكن استخدام نقاط الدخول التي يملكها مشروع Google Cloud الذي أنشأ المساحة إلا للانضمام إلى الاجتماعات في هذه المساحة. يمكن للتطبيقات استخدام حزمة Meet Embed SDK للويب أو حِزم Meet SDK للأجهزة الجوّالة لإنشاء نقاط دخول مملوكة.

الإشراف

وضع الإشراف على اجتماع. عندما يكون وضع الإشراف مفعّلاً، يحصل مالك الاجتماع على مزيد من التحكّم في الاجتماع من خلال ميزات مثل إدارة المضيف المشارك (راجِع رسالة "المشارك") والقيود المفروضة على الميزات (راجِع رسالة "قيود الإشراف").

عمليات التعداد
MODERATION_UNSPECIFIED لم يتم تحديد نوع الإشراف. يُستخدَم هذا للإشارة إلى أنّ المستخدم لم يحدّد أي قيمة لأنّه لا يريد تعديل الحالة. لا يُسمح للمستخدمين بضبط القيمة على "غير محدّد".
OFF تكون ميزة الإشراف غير مفعّلة.
ON ميزة الإشراف مفعّلة.

ModerationRestrictions

لتحديد القيود المفروضة على الميزات عندما يكون الاجتماع مُدارًا

تمثيل JSON
{
  "chatRestriction": enum (RestrictionType),
  "reactionRestriction": enum (RestrictionType),
  "presentRestriction": enum (RestrictionType),
  "defaultJoinAsViewerType": enum (DefaultJoinAsViewerType)
}
الحقول
chatRestriction

enum (RestrictionType)

لتحديد المستخدمين الذين لديهم الإذن بإرسال رسائل المحادثة في مساحة الاجتماع

reactionRestriction

enum (RestrictionType)

تُحدِّد المستخدمين الذين لديهم الإذن بإرسال التفاعلات في مساحة الاجتماع.

presentRestriction

enum (RestrictionType)

لتحديد المستخدمين الذين لديهم الإذن بمشاركة شاشاتهم في مساحة الاجتماع

defaultJoinAsViewerType

enum (DefaultJoinAsViewerType)

يحدِّد ما إذا كان سيتم حصر الدور التلقائي الذي تم إسناده إلى المستخدمين على "مُشاهد".

RestrictionType

لتحديد المستخدمين الذين لديهم الإذن باستخدام ميزة معيّنة.

عمليات التعداد
RESTRICTION_TYPE_UNSPECIFIED القيمة التلقائية المحدّدة من خلال سياسة المستخدم ولا يُفترَض أن يتم إرجاع هذا الرمز أبدًا.
HOSTS_ONLY يحصل مالك الاجتماع والمضيف المشارك على الإذن.
NO_RESTRICTION يحصل جميع المشاركين على الأذونات.

DefaultJoinAsViewerType

سينضم المستخدمون تلقائيًا كمساهمين. يمكن للمضيفين حصر إمكانية انضمام المستخدمين كمشاهدين. ملاحظة: في حال ضبط دور صريح للمستخدمين في مورد "العضو"، سينضم المستخدم إلى هذا الدور.

عمليات التعداد
DEFAULT_JOIN_AS_VIEWER_TYPE_UNSPECIFIED القيمة التلقائية المحدّدة من خلال سياسة المستخدم ولا يُفترَض أن يتم إرجاع هذا الرمز أبدًا.
ON سينضم المستخدمون تلقائيًا كمشاهدين.
OFF سينضم المستخدمون تلقائيًا كمساهمين.

AttendanceReportGenerationType

الحالات المحتمَلة لتمكين تقرير الحضور لمساحة الاجتماع

عمليات التعداد
ATTENDANCE_REPORT_GENERATION_TYPE_UNSPECIFIED القيمة التلقائية المحدّدة من خلال سياسة المستخدم ولا يُفترَض أن يتم إرجاع هذا الرمز أبدًا.
GENERATE_REPORT سيتم إنشاء تقرير الحضور وإرساله إلى Drive/البريد الإلكتروني.
DO_NOT_GENERATE لن يتم إنشاء تقرير الحضور.

ArtifactConfig

الإعدادات ذات الصلة بعناصر الاجتماعات التي قد يتم إنشاؤها بواسطة مساحة الاجتماعات هذه

تمثيل JSON
{
  "recordingConfig": {
    object (RecordingConfig)
  },
  "transcriptionConfig": {
    object (TranscriptionConfig)
  },
  "smartNotesConfig": {
    object (SmartNotesConfig)
  }
}
الحقول
recordingConfig

object (RecordingConfig)

الإعدادات الخاصة بالتسجيل

transcriptionConfig

object (TranscriptionConfig)

إعدادات التحويل التلقائي إلى نص

smartNotesConfig

object (SmartNotesConfig)

إعدادات الملاحظات الذكية التلقائية

RecordingConfig

الإعدادات ذات الصلة بالتسجيل في مساحة اجتماع

تمثيل JSON
{
  "autoRecordingGeneration": enum (AutoGenerationType)
}
الحقول
autoRecordingGeneration

enum (AutoGenerationType)

يحدِّد ما إذا كان سيتم تسجيل مساحة اجتماع تلقائيًا عندما ينضم مستخدم لديه امتياز التسجيل إلى الاجتماع.

AutoGenerationType

لتحديد ما إذا كان يمكن إنشاء عنصر تلقائيًا في مساحة الاجتماع.

عمليات التعداد
AUTO_GENERATION_TYPE_UNSPECIFIED القيمة التلقائية المحدّدة من خلال سياسة المستخدم ولا يُفترَض أن يتم إرجاع هذا الرمز أبدًا.
ON يتم إنشاء العنصر تلقائيًا.
OFF لا يتم إنشاء العنصر تلقائيًا.

TranscriptionConfig

الإعدادات ذات الصلة بتحويل الصوت إلى نص في مساحة اجتماع

تمثيل JSON
{
  "autoTranscriptionGeneration": enum (AutoGenerationType)
}
الحقول
autoTranscriptionGeneration

enum (AutoGenerationType)

يحدِّد ما إذا كان سيتم تحويل محتوى الاجتماع إلى نص تلقائيًا عندما ينضم مستخدم لديه امتياز تحويل الصوت إلى نص إلى الاجتماع.

SmartNotesConfig

الإعدادات المتعلّقة بالملاحظات الذكية في مساحة اجتماع لمزيد من المعلومات حول الملخّصات الذكية، يُرجى الاطّلاع على مقالة ميزة"دوّن لي ملاحظات الاجتماع" في Google Meet.

تمثيل JSON
{
  "autoSmartNotesGeneration": enum (AutoGenerationType)
}
الحقول
autoSmartNotesGeneration

enum (AutoGenerationType)

يحدِّد ما إذا كان سيتم تلقائيًا إنشاء ملخّص وملخّص للاجتماع لجميع المدعوين في المؤسسة عندما ينضم مستخدم لديه امتياز تفعيل الملاحظات الذكية إلى الاجتماع.

ActiveConference

مكالمة فيديو نشطة

تمثيل JSON
{
  "conferenceRecord": string
}
الحقول
conferenceRecord

string

النتائج فقط. إشارة إلى المرجع "ConferenceRecord" التنسيق: conferenceRecords/{conferenceRecord} حيث يكون {conferenceRecord} معرّفًا فريدًا لكلّ نسخة من المكالمة ضمن مساحة.

الطُرق

create

لإنشاء مساحة

endActiveConference

لإنهاء اجتماع فيديو نشط (إذا كان هناك اجتماع).

get

الحصول على تفاصيل عن مساحة اجتماع

patch

تعديل تفاصيل حول مساحة اجتماع